During the second visit, a nurse noticed that although an elderly gentleman had not been able to clean up the apartment, he had been able to clean up the kitchen. Why would the nurse praise him for his cleaning efforts when only one room had changed?
 
  a. It demonstrated that the home-bound man was trying to be compliant with the nurse's suggestion.
  b. It made the apartment so much nicer for both the client and the nurse.
  c. It was a successful short-term achievement toward the long-term goal of environmental safety.
  d. The elderly gentleman obviously expected considerable praise for doing such a female task.

Question 2

Which of the following would be the first priority when a nurse is completing a home visit?
 
  a. Consistency with agency rules and procedures
  b. Legally, whatever the medical referral requires
  c. Unless a medical emergency, whatever the client believes is most important
  d. What the nurse's professional judgment determines to be the major threat to health

Bisphosphonates were first developed in the nineteenth century. They were first investigated for use in disorders of bone metabolism in the 1960s. They are now used clinically for the treatment of osteoporosis, Paget's disease, bone metastasis, multiple myeloma, and other conditions that feature bone fragility.
